1 /*
2  * Implementation of get_cpuid().
3  *
4  * Copyright IBM Corp. 2014, 2018
5  * Author(s): Alexander Yarygin <yarygin@linux.vnet.ibm.com>
6  *            Thomas Richter <tmricht@linux.vnet.ibm.com>
7  *
8  * This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ify
9  * it under the terms of the GNU General Public License (version 2 only)
10  * as published by the Free Software Foundation.
11  */
12
13 #include <sys/types.h>
14 #include <unistd.h>
15 #include <stdio.h>
16 #include <string.h>
17 #include <ctype.h>
18
19 #include "../../util/header.h"
20 #include "../../util/util.h"
21
22 #define SYSINFO_MANU    "Manufacturer:"
23 #define SYSINFO_TYPE    "Type:"
24 #define SYSINFO_MODEL   "Model:"
25 #define SRVLVL_CPUMF    "CPU-MF:"
26 #define SRVLVL_VERSION  "version="
27 #define SRVLVL_AUTHORIZATION    "authorization="
28 #define SYSINFO         "/proc/sysinfo"
29 #define SRVLVL          "/proc/service_levels"
30
31 int get_cpuid(char *buffer, size_t sz)
32 {
33         char *cp, *line = NULL, *line2;
34         char type[8], model[33], version[8], manufacturer[32], authorization[8];
35         int tpsize = 0, mdsize = 0, vssize = 0, mfsize = 0, atsize = 0;
36         int read;
37         unsigned long line_sz;
38         size_t nbytes;
39         FILE *sysinfo;
40
41         /*
42          * Scan /proc/sysinfo line by line and read out values for
43          * Manufacturer:, Type: and Model:, for example:
44          * Manufacturer:    IBM
45          * Type:            2964
46          * Model:           702              N96
47          * The first word is the Model Capacity and the second word is
48          * Model (can be omitted). Both words have a maximum size of 16
49          * bytes.
50          */
51         memset(manufacturer, 0, sizeof(manufacturer));
52         memset(type, 0, sizeof(type));
53         memset(model, 0, sizeof(model));
54         memset(version, 0, sizeof(version));
55         memset(authorization, 0, sizeof(authorization));
56
57         sysinfo = fopen(SYSINFO, "r");
58         if (sysinfo == NULL)
59                 return -1;
60
61         while ((read = getline(&line, &line_sz, sysinfo)) != -1) {
62                 if (!strncmp(line, SYSINFO_MANU, strlen(SYSINFO_MANU))) {
63                         line2 = line + strlen(SYSINFO_MANU);
64
65                         while ((cp = strtok_r(line2, "\n ", &line2))) {
66                                 mfsize += scnprintf(manufacturer + mfsize,
67                                                     sizeof(manufacturer) - mfsize, "%s", cp);
68                         }
69                 }
70
71                 if (!strncmp(line, SYSINFO_TYPE, strlen(SYSINFO_TYPE))) {
72                         line2 = line + strlen(SYSINFO_TYPE);
73
74                         while ((cp = strtok_r(line2, "\n ", &line2))) {
75                                 tpsize += scnprintf(type + tpsize,
76                                                     sizeof(type) - tpsize, "%s", cp);
77                         }
78                 }
79
80                 if (!strncmp(line, SYSINFO_MODEL, strlen(SYSINFO_MODEL))) {
81                         line2 = line + strlen(SYSINFO_MODEL);
82
83                         while ((cp = strtok_r(line2, "\n ", &line2))) {
84                                 mdsize += scnprintf(model + mdsize, sizeof(model) - mdsize,
85                                                     "%s%s", model[0] ? "," : "", cp);
86                         }
87                         break;
88                 }
89         }
90         fclose(sysinfo);
91
92         /* Missing manufacturer, type or model information should not happen */
93         if (!manufacturer[0] || !type[0] || !model[0])
94                 return -1;
95
96         /*
97          * Scan /proc/service_levels and return the CPU-MF counter facility
98          * version number and authorization level.
99          * Optional, does not exist on z/VM guests.
100          */
101         sysinfo = fopen(SRVLVL, "r");
102         if (sysinfo == NULL)
103                 goto skip_sysinfo;
104         while ((read = getline(&line, &line_sz, sysinfo)) != -1) {
105                 if (strncmp(line, SRVLVL_CPUMF, strlen(SRVLVL_CPUMF)))
106                         continue;
107
108                 line2 = line + strlen(SRVLVL_CPUMF);
109                 while ((cp = strtok_r(line2, "\n ", &line2))) {
110                         if (!strncmp(cp, SRVLVL_VERSION,
111                                      strlen(SRVLVL_VERSION))) {
112                                 char *sep = strchr(cp, '=');
113
114                                 vssize += scnprintf(version + vssize,
115                                                     sizeof(version) - vssize, "%s", sep + 1);
116                         }
117                         if (!strncmp(cp, SRVLVL_AUTHORIZATION,
118                                      strlen(SRVLVL_AUTHORIZATION))) {
119                                 char *sep = strchr(cp, '=');
120
121                                 atsize += scnprintf(authorization + atsize,
122                                                     sizeof(authorization) - atsize, "%s", sep + 1);
123                         }
124                 }
125         }
126         fclose(sysinfo);
127
128 skip_sysinfo:
129         free(line);
130
131         if (version[0] && authorization[0] )
132                 nbytes = snprintf(buffer, sz, "%s,%s,%s,%s,%s",
133                                   manufacturer, type, model, version,
134                                   authorization);
135         else
136                 nbytes = snprintf(buffer, sz, "%s,%s,%s", manufacturer, type,
137                                   model);
138         return (nbytes >= sz) ? -1 : 0;
139 }
140
141 char *get_cpuid_str(struct perf_pmu *pmu __maybe_unused)
142 {
143         char *buf = malloc(128);
144
145         if (buf && get_cpuid(buf, 128) < 0)
146                 zfree(&buf);
147         return buf;
148 }
